Kadunna – Abuja Train Crash Sparks Panic

Hundreds of passengers were left stranded on Monday morning after an Abuja-bound train travelling from Kaduna collided with another train along the same rail corridor.

 

The crash forced an immediate halt to operations on one of Nigeria’s busiest railway routes during the peak morning commute.

 

The incident happened shortly after the train departed Kaduna and encountered another train on the track.

 

Details about the exact movement of the two trains are still emerging, but the impact brought both locomotives to an abrupt stop and disrupted travel for passengers heading to the capital.

 

Passengers described the moment of impact as a “sudden and violent jolt” that shook the coaches and caused panic among travellers.

 

One passenger said “We were moving at a steady pace when there was a loud bang and the train suddenly braked,” adding “We later realized we had hit another train on the same track. Everyone is shaken, but we are waiting for official word.”

 

Another traveller, Sada Malumfashi, also described the moment online, saying “Just dropped from the Kaduna-Abuja train. We heard a loud bang and the train jolted to a stop flinging people across.

 

Passengers got hit and most are bleeding and severely injured,” while also noting “Train delayed for some 30 minutes and resumed to Kubwa.

 

No communication from @info_NRC on anything.”
Emergency teams and security personnel were later sent to the scene to evacuate passengers and secure the area.

 

While early reports suggest the collision damaged the front sections of the trains, there were no confirmed fatalities at the time, though the incident has raised concerns about signalling systems and safety measures on the route.
